About The Position

The Product Manager will be responsible for defining and executing a U.S. domestic content strategy for assigned products. This includes ensuring product architectures, sourcing strategies, and cost models support U.S. manufacturing, localization, and applicable domestic content requirements, while maintaining competitiveness, quality, and supply continuity.
